在将heartbeat应用到生产环境中,还是有许多要注意的地方,一不小心就可能导致heartbeat无法切换或脑裂的情况,下面来介绍下由于iptables导致脑裂的现象。
主:192.168.3.218
192.168.4.218 心跳ip
usvr-218 主机名
备:192.168.3.128
192.168.4.128 心跳ip
us...
分类:
其他好文 时间:
2015-02-01 21:56:35
阅读次数:
331
线上将两台lvs服务器做heartbeat热备,但是配置启动后,发现报错:
Jan 28 15:50:22 usvr-211 heartbeat: [2266]: ERROR: should_drop_message: attempted replay attack [usvr-210]? [gen = 1418354318, curgen = 1418354319]
Jan 28 15:50...
分类:
其他好文 时间:
2015-02-01 21:56:07
阅读次数:
259
heartbeat架好后,我们就需要监控起来喽,下面我们就来了解下怎么监控。
首先来了解下几个命令,这几个命令在heartbeat安装后会自动加上,我们的监控脚本就用到这几个命令。
[root@usvr-210 libexec]# which cl_status
/usr/bin/cl_status
[root@usvr-210 libexec]# cl_status listnodes...
分类:
移动开发 时间:
2015-02-01 21:55:15
阅读次数:
286
在将heartbeat应用到线上后,启动service heartbeat start,发现之后就再没反应了,查看日志tail -f /var/log/ha-log如下:
heartbeat[30680]: 2015/01/27_18:04:29 info: Version 2 support: false
heartbeat[30680]: 2015/01/27_18:04:29 WARN:...
分类:
其他好文 时间:
2015-02-01 21:54:08
阅读次数:
253
pacemaker:心脏起搏器,是一个集群资源管理器。它实现最大可用性群集服务的节点和资源级别故障检测和恢复使用首选集群基础设施提供的消息和成员能力。pacemaker是个资源管理器,不提供心跳信息。heartbeat3.0拆分后的组成部分:heartbeat:将原来的消息通信层独立为heartbeat项..
分类:
Web程序 时间:
2015-01-23 18:34:42
阅读次数:
300
配置信息:
Primary:
Name:zbdba1
OS:redhat 6.3
IP:192.168.56.220
drbd:8.4.0
heartbeat:3.0.4
Standby:
Name:zbdba2
OS:Redhat 6.3
IP:192.168.56.221
drbd:8.4.0
heartbeat:3.0.4
主要分为如下步骤:
1、安装DRBD
2、安装Mysql...
分类:
数据库 时间:
2015-01-21 11:49:56
阅读次数:
329
基本环境准备;[root@localhost~]#vim/etc/sysconfig/network(修改主机名)NETWORKING=yesHOSTNAME=node1.dragon.com(这里每台主机自行修改为node1,2,3)[root@localhost~]#vim/etc/hosts(修改主机文件,分别指向node1,2,3)127.0.0.1localhostlocalhost.localdomainlocalho..
分类:
其他好文 时间:
2015-01-19 06:59:25
阅读次数:
401
准备工作1、实验拓扑图2、实验时最好事先关闭防火墙与SELinux(两节点都要配置)node1,node2:[root@node~]#serviceiptablesstop[root@node~]#vim/etc/selinux/configSELINUX=disabled3、节点之前主机名互相解析:一定确保主机名和uname-n一致[root@node~]#vim/etc/hosts10.10.0..
分类:
Web程序 时间:
2015-01-13 20:03:43
阅读次数:
244
拓扑图:主要步骤:1.搭建lemp平台2.Nginx做缓存及代理均衡3.nginx-keepalived双主互备反向代理4.”免“验证rsync-inotify同步数据5.mysql主从及amoeba读写分离6.DRBD-heartbeat-NFS
分类:
其他好文 时间:
2015-01-12 11:09:20
阅读次数:
639
利用heartbeat实现高可用集群heartbeat是一个可以提供messagingLayer层的软件,他有三个版本(v1、v2、v3),本实验使用heartbeatv2版本,由于v2版本自带了2个资源管理器heartbeat和crm,因此,本文会分别实现2个不同的资源管理器来实现高可用集群。一、利用heartbeat自带的资..
分类:
其他好文 时间:
2015-01-12 06:54:43
阅读次数:
214